Output 2f42bb9668c3aab4b3f50d4099974db214cb2eb6cbce85bd4739e2cdce588e4e:1

value
1344263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cabc0a33b372a44a1eab41f12b65c30abbd9071 OP_EQUAL
address
3D4DTuKurw3WSjruYWhsVfWSXpvc3Uq4xf
transaction
2f42bb9668c3aab4b3f50d4099974db214cb2eb6cbce85bd4739e2cdce588e4e
spent
true